It’s odd how often the same script shows up from the same number, promising refunds for mysterious overcharges. Most callers claim to be from “Merchant Services” and pressure you to share merchant IDs, statements, or tax info. That tactic is a classic phishing move: they create urgency, cite PCI compliance, and request sensitive data. Never hand over account numbers, banking details, or personal identifiers without verifying the caller through your known provider’s official channel. Hang up, log the call details, and add the number to your do‑not‑call list. Consider reporting the incident to the FCC or your state consumer protection agency for further action.
